Software developers reasoning behind adoption and use of software development methods – a systematic literature review

Detalhes bibliográficos
Autor(a) principal: Havstorm, Tanja Elina
Data de Publicação: 2023
Outros Autores: Karlsson, Fredrik
Tipo de documento: Artigo
Idioma: eng
Título da fonte: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
Texto Completo: https://doi.org/10.12821/ijispm110203
Resumo: When adopting and using a Software Development Method (SDM), it is important to stay true to the philosophy of the method; otherwise, software developers might execute activities that do not lead to the intended outcomes. Currently, no overview of SDM research addresses software developers’ reasoning behind adopting and using SDMs. Accordingly, this paper aims to survey existing SDM research to scrutinize the current knowledge base on software developers’ type of reasoning behind SDM adoption and use. We executed a systematic literature review and analyzed existing research using two steps. First, we classified papers based on what type of reasoning was addressed regarding SDM adoption and use: rational, irrational, and non-rational. Second, we made a thematic synthesis across these three types of reasoning to provide a more detailed characterization of the existing research. We elicited 28 studies addressing software developers’ reasoning and identified five research themes. Building on these themes, we framed four future research directions with four broad research questions, which can be used as a basis for future research.
id RCAP_ab0330dafdbf60ff965d7c90e8959a52
oai_identifier_str oai:journals.uminho.pt:article/5199
network_acronym_str RCAP
network_name_str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
repository_id_str 7160
spelling Software developers reasoning behind adoption and use of software development methods – a systematic literature reviewsystems development methodsoftware development methodsystematic literature reviewuseadoptionWhen adopting and using a Software Development Method (SDM), it is important to stay true to the philosophy of the method; otherwise, software developers might execute activities that do not lead to the intended outcomes. Currently, no overview of SDM research addresses software developers’ reasoning behind adopting and using SDMs. Accordingly, this paper aims to survey existing SDM research to scrutinize the current knowledge base on software developers’ type of reasoning behind SDM adoption and use. We executed a systematic literature review and analyzed existing research using two steps. First, we classified papers based on what type of reasoning was addressed regarding SDM adoption and use: rational, irrational, and non-rational. Second, we made a thematic synthesis across these three types of reasoning to provide a more detailed characterization of the existing research. We elicited 28 studies addressing software developers’ reasoning and identified five research themes. Building on these themes, we framed four future research directions with four broad research questions, which can be used as a basis for future research.UMinho Editora2023-07-11info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/articleapplication/pdfhttps://doi.org/10.12821/ijispm110203https://doi.org/10.12821/ijispm110203International Journal of Information Systems and Project Management; Vol. 11 N.º 2 (2023); 47-78International Journal of Information Systems and Project Management; Vol. 11 No. 2 (2023); 47-782182-7788repon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ãoinstacron:RCAAPenghttps://revistas.uminho.pt/index.php/ijispm/article/view/5199https://revistas.uminho.pt/index.php/ijispm/article/view/5199/5742Havstorm, Tanja ElinaKarlsson, Fredrikinfo:eu-repo/semantics/openAccess2023-07-15T09:30:14Zoai:journals.uminho.pt:article/5199Portal AgregadorONGhttps://www.rcaap.pt/oai/openaireopendoar:71602024-03-19T18:34:48.939786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ãofalse
dc.title.none.fl_str_mv Software developers reasoning behind adoption and use of software development methods – a systematic literature review
title Software developers reasoning behind adoption and use of software development methods – a systematic literature review
spellingShingle Software developers reasoning behind adoption and use of software development methods – a systematic literature review
Havstorm, Tanja Elina
systems development method
software development method
systematic literature review
use
adoption
title_short Software developers reasoning behind adoption and use of software development methods – a systematic literature review
title_full Software developers reasoning behind adoption and use of software development methods – a systematic literature review
title_fullStr Software developers reasoning behind adoption and use of software development methods – a systematic literature review
title_full_unstemmed Software developers reasoning behind adoption and use of software development methods – a systematic literature review
title_sort Software developers reasoning behind adoption and use of software development methods – a systematic literature review
author Havstorm, Tanja Elina
author_facet Havstorm, Tanja Elina
Karlsson, Fredrik
author_role author
author2 Karlsson, Fredrik
author2_role author
dc.contributor.author.fl_str_mv Havstorm, Tanja Elina
Karlsson, Fredrik
dc.subject.por.fl_str_mv systems development method
software development method
systematic literature review
use
adoption
topic systems development method
software development method
systematic literature review
use
adoption
description When adopting and using a Software Development Method (SDM), it is important to stay true to the philosophy of the method; otherwise, software developers might execute activities that do not lead to the intended outcomes. Currently, no overview of SDM research addresses software developers’ reasoning behind adopting and using SDMs. Accordingly, this paper aims to survey existing SDM research to scrutinize the current knowledge base on software developers’ type of reasoning behind SDM adoption and use. We executed a systematic literature review and analyzed existing research using two steps. First, we classified papers based on what type of reasoning was addressed regarding SDM adoption and use: rational, irrational, and non-rational. Second, we made a thematic synthesis across these three types of reasoning to provide a more detailed characterization of the existing research. We elicited 28 studies addressing software developers’ reasoning and identified five research themes. Building on these themes, we framed four future research directions with four broad research questions, which can be used as a basis for future research.
publishDate 2023
dc.date.none.fl_str_mv 2023-07-11
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/article
format article
status_str publishedVersion
dc.identifier.uri.fl_str_mv https://doi.org/10.12821/ijispm110203
https://doi.org/10.12821/ijispm110203
url https://doi.org/10.12821/ijispm110203
dc.language.iso.fl_str_mv eng
language eng
dc.relation.none.fl_str_mv https://revistas.uminho.pt/index.php/ijispm/article/view/5199
https://revistas.uminho.pt/index.php/ijispm/article/view/5199/5742
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
dc.publisher.none.fl_str_mv UMinho Editora
publisher.none.fl_str_mv UMinho Editora
dc.source.none.fl_str_mv International Journal of Information Systems and Project Management; Vol. 11 N.º 2 (2023); 47-78
International Journal of Information Systems and Project Management; Vol. 11 No. 2 (2023); 47-78
2182-7788
repon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
instacron:RCAAP
instname_str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
instacron_str RCAAP
institution RCAAP
reponame_str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
collection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)
repository.name.fl_str_mv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ação
repository.mail.fl_str_mv
_version_ 1799132074509074432